### Step 4 — Import credentials

Before the Tallowfield catalogue import runs, the worker needs write access to the Shelfwright staging bucket. Heads up for review: the credential is scoped to imports only and expires after 30 days, so nothing long-lived sits on disk. Drop it into the worker's .env as the line below:

sealed setting: VAULT_KEY3=eec

# Who to Contact: Flaky DNS Resolution

If you see intermittent NXDOMAIN errors from the Larkmere staging cluster, the likely culprit is the Quillhost resolver cache, which occasionally serves stale entries after a zone push. First, confirm the failure is reproducible from at least two nodes and note the exact timestamps, since the resolver team rotates logs hourly. Once you have that evidence, send your findings and timestamps to the resolver on-call inbox shown below.

escalation mailbox, hadug-bajog: sormir@norvalabs.internal

Looks good overall! One heads-up for folks new to the Ledgerpine codebase: this changes the payroll export from fixed-width to delimited, and downstream at Finchport's importer we still have to respect their batch-size and padding quirks, so don't "clean those up" even though they look weird. I'd add a comment pointing at the exporter spec so the next person doesn't trip on it. Also double-check the rounding mode matches what accounting expects. The relevant tuning constants are these.

tuning table, fawip-fahag:
WEIGHTS = {
    "novwyn": 452,
    "casdor": 675,
}

MEMO — Support Outsourcing Plan

Torben, since you're taking over next week, here's the state of play. We're moving tier-one customer support to Cravelle Partners on a twelve-month pilot, keeping tier-two in-house at the Norfield office. Projected saving is about 18%, assuming attrition stays manageable. Staff comms are drafted but not sent — that call is yours. One point below is for your eyes only.

confidential, fahip-bagep: The southern region missed its Holwyn quota by 21.5 percent last quarter. Sorvanek Foods plans to raise the Jorir list price by 23.9 percent in December. The pricing group signed off on a budget of $411.6 million for Project Eliion. The renewal with Juldorix Works closes at $87.9 million a year, 16.8 percent below the last contract.